中文摘要:“科举”一词有广义与狭义之分。广义的科举指分科举人 ,即西汉以后分科目察举或制诏甄试人才授予官职的制度 ;狭义的科举指进士科举 ,即隋代设立进士科以后用考试来选拔人才授予官职的制度。进士科举不始于隋文帝时而始于隋炀帝大业元年。炀帝始建进士科时并未予以特别的重视 ,进士科举的重要意义是因后来它在中国社会政治和文化教育上影响日益重大而为后人所赋予的
英文摘要:The term “imperial examination” can be used in both a broad and a narrow sense. In a broad sense, it means the system adopted after the Western Han Dynasty for selecting talented individuals by different means, that is, recommending or examining (under imperial orders) talented individuals in order to confer on them government posts. In a narrow sense, it refers to the jinshi keju , that is, the jinshi examination that started in the Sui Dynasty and was used to select talented individuals by examination and confer on them government posts. The jinshi keju was initiated in the first year of the Daye reign period of Emperor Yang of the Sui Dynasty, and not during the reign of Emperor Wen. Although the jinshi examination was adopted by Emperor Yang, he never attached particular importance to this examination, and it became important only after it became increasingly influential in the political and cultural education of Chinese society.
